Dean Smith felt the grass at Elland Road was a little long, which Leeds found hilarious.
Dean Smith manager of Brentford
Leeds United finally won their first game of 2018 earlier today, beating Brentford 1-0 at Elland Road.
Liam Cooper headed the only goal of the game as Leeds picked up three points and perhaps kept their slim hopes of the play-offs alive.
It was a solid and composed performance from Leeds and few could argue they didn’t deserve the win.
But Brentford boss Dean Smith was not happy after the game. He felt that Leeds got the rub of the green in the fixture from the referee. He also complained about the length of the Elland Road grass.
As reported by the YEP on twitter it was suggested that Smith was not happy with the turf at Leeds, which obviously saw Leeds fans aim pelters at their rival’s boss for sour grapes.
The fans were not alone. In fact, the official Leeds United twitter account got involved as well.
They sent this tweet after the game, clearly in the direction of the Brentford manager:
